  • Angela Merkel, Europe’s most influential personality in the 21st century is getting ready to give up power. Emilia, Berlin correspondent for a European media company, has been selected to take part in a panel of journalists and will ask Merkel one question. But which question? She proceeds with an investigation and interviews to find THE exact right question.


    My question to Angela Merkel is a documentary podcast. The journalistic investigation relies on exhaustive research and exclusive testimonies coming from several European personalities (Alexis Tsipras, François Hollande, Jean Claude Juncker, etc). A smaller fictional picture is created to present a greater factual history.

  • Episode 1 - Baby Merkel: Angie Kasner
    Sep 14 2021

    In this episode, Emilia starts her quest for the perfect question to ask Angela Merkel by looking into her origins. We find out about her life as the daughter of a protestant pastor on an evangelical mission in East Germany. We learn all about her brilliant track record as a student, about her nerd side, about the time she defied the DDR authorities by reading a censored poem. We understand together how she could be seen both as a Western girl in East Germany and as “the Easterner” from the perspective of Western Germans.


    The guests featured in this episode are:


    • Joyce Mushaben, political scientist, former Professor at Georgetown University and author of “Becoming Madam Chancellor: Angela Merkel and the Berlin Republic”.
    • Rainer Eppelmann, politician, former DDR Minister and CDU member.

  • Episode 2 - The Fall of the Berlin Wall and Angie at the sauna
    Sep 16 2021

    After having delved into her origins in the previous episode, Emilia moves on to investigate what Angela was up to in her late 20s and her early 30s. We find out how Miss Angela Kasner became Mrs Angela Merkel and how she cleverly managed to avoid working for the Stasi. We discover where she was when the Berlin Wall was being torn down and what she did after such an event so pivotal in Germany’s history.


    The guests featured in this episode are:


    • Joyce Mushaben, political scientist, former Professor at Georgetown University and author of “Becoming Madam Chancellor: Angela Merkel and the Berlin Republic”.
    • Michael Schindhelm, filmmaker, curator and former colleague of Angela Merkel at a laboratory in East Germany.
    • Rainer Eppelmann, politician, former DDR Minister and CDU member.
